Output 56228ecca05f16e10ce868b64bb012b66f94ef201751106aaea1f93923d5677e:0

value
32879223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3c7d23ac6db739a0ee70718a35c156adc763e5 OP_EQUAL
address
3Jwc6du5AZ9vekj4xJqH4ja1wfXMFkigPy
transaction
56228ecca05f16e10ce868b64bb012b66f94ef201751106aaea1f93923d5677e
spent
true